Nora spent a total of 8 1/6 hours on community service last year. Given that her visit to the old folks' home made up 4/7 of the

total time on community service, find the amount of time she spend on visiting the old folks' homes.

Answer:

The amount of time she spend on visiting the old folks' homes is \frac{14}{3} hours.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: Nora spent a total of 8\frac{1}{6} hours on community service last year. Given that her visit to the old folks' home made up \frac{4}{7} of the total time on community service.

To find : The amount of time she spend on visiting the old folks' homes ?

Solution :

Time Nora spent on community service last year is 8\frac{1}{6}=\frac{49}{6} hours.

Her visit to the old folks' home made up of teh total time on community service is \frac{4}{7}

So, The amount of time she spend on visiting the old folks' homes is

t=\frac{49}{6}\times\frac{4}{7}

t=\frac{14}{3}

Therefore, The amount of time she spend on visiting the old folks' homes is \frac{14}{3} hours.
